Spicy Tomato Chicken Stir-Fry

A fiery and flavorful chicken stir-fry with a tangy tomato sauce, sautéed onions, and colorful peppers.

Main Dish
Intermediate 30 min 400 cal
Steps

1. Heat vegetable oil in a large pan over medium heat. 2. Add onion, bell peppers, garlic, and ginger. Sauté until onions are translucent and peppers are slightly tender. 3. Push the vegetables to one side of the pan and add the chicken breast. Cook until chicken is browned and cooked through. 4. In a small bowl, mix soy sauce, hot sauce, and diced tomatoes. Pour the mixture over the chicken and vegetables. 5. Stir everything together and let it simmer for a few minutes until the sauce thickens slightly. 6. Season with salt and pepper to taste. 7. Serve hot with steamed rice or noodles.

Ingredients

1 chicken breast 1/2 onion, thinly sliced 1/2 red bell pepper, sliced 1/2 green bell pepper, sliced 1 tomato, diced 2 tablespoons vegetable oil 2 cloves garlic, minced 1 teaspoon ginger, grated 2 tablespoons soy sauce 1 tablespoon hot sauce (adjust to taste) Salt and pepper to taste
